In a move that reflects the increasing participation of ladies in their homes, Jotun Paints, one of the world's leading producers and suppliers of paints, coatings and powder coatings, has launched the 'Lady' interior brand into the Middle East market at a press conference held yesterday (May 7, 2007) at the company's Al Quoz office. The pioneering move introduces the interior paint brand, which utilizes the latest technology in emulsion paints, to cater to a growing niche market in the Middle East looking for high-quality and versatility in interior paints for home decoration.
The launch of the interior brand follows two years of extensive research in the regional Dubai-based R&D laboratory in close collaboration with Jotun Norway to come up with an interior paint brand which provides unrivalled home painting solution. Discerning female consumers and families now have high-quality acrylic paints in a beautiful matt finish that offers unique benefits that no other paint in the market can provide-- easy clean, neutral scent and color last. Cleaning stains and dirt off painted walls will not leave any spots or affect the quality of the paint finishing. Further, the solvent-free paints do not leave any trace of odor after 6 hours of application, and the colors are guaranteed to last for years.

About Jotun Paints:
Founded in 1926 in Norway, Jotun - one of the world's leading paint manufacturers established its presence in the Middle East in 1974, with Jotun UAE Ltd. Ever since, Jotun has expanded dramatically throughout the region and is the first paint manufacturer to be awarded the ISO 9001 certification. Jotun has consistently invested in state of the art factories including the recently opened plant in the Al Quoz area of Dubai, UAE - the biggest worldwide for Jotun and the Middle East.
Jotun has been at the forefront in terms of developing products specifically suited to local conditions. Three decades of experience in the Middle East region, has helped the company produce a variety of conventional and specialized coatings - each incorporating the latest technological developments while offering performance with economy - catering to the various product segments and demands of the different markets. Today, Jotun's diverse product range includes Decorative, Protective, Marine, Floor/Concrete Protection and Intumescent coatings, bearing a solid testament to the company's reputation of being truly a single source solution for clients, consultants and contractors alike.
